1
0
Fork 0
mirror of synced 2024-06-02 19:04:49 +12:00

Merge branch '0.15.x' of https://github.com/appwrite/appwrite into feat-prepare-0-15

This commit is contained in:
Torsten Dittmann 2022-06-20 23:38:57 +02:00
commit 9d7db047e6

View file

@ -909,6 +909,7 @@ App::post('/v1/account/sessions/phone')
$token = new Document([
'$id' => $dbForProject->getId(),
'userId' => $user->getId(),
'userInternalId' => $user->getInternalId(),
'type' => Auth::TOKEN_TYPE_PHONE,
'secret' => $secret,
'expire' => $expire,
@ -995,6 +996,7 @@ App::put('/v1/account/sessions/phone')
[
'$id' => $dbForProject->getId(),
'userId' => $user->getId(),
'userInternalId' => $user->getInternalId(),
'provider' => Auth::SESSION_PROVIDER_PHONE,
'secret' => Auth::hash($secret), // One way hash encryption to protect DB leak
'expire' => $expiry,
@ -2281,6 +2283,7 @@ App::post('/v1/account/verification/phone')
$verification = new Document([
'$id' => $dbForProject->getId(),
'userId' => $user->getId(),
'userInternalId' => $user->getInternalId(),
'type' => Auth::TOKEN_TYPE_PHONE,
'secret' => $secret,
'expire' => $expire,